Peer Block blocking youre sight.

Recommended Posts

Just to let you know I use Peer block, I realize you say I don't need it but its just another small part of my protection, the reason I mention this is because peer block has recently started blocking you're site and I think it might be interfering with my connection to the VPN. It says it is Blocking Lease Web.

Hello!

Using PeerBlock is surely a courtesy toward us, because it may slightly help us receive less bogus copyright infringement notices. However, the PeerBlock protection against them is so small, that you can safely renounce to it.

If you wish to use PeerBlock anyway, you will have to remove from the blocklist you're using the LeaseWeb entry and exit-IP addresses of our servers with LeaseWeb:

- all the NL servers

- Tauri in Germany

- Librae and Sirius in the USA

or you'll have to use a non-LeaseWeb server.

The solution to allow our servers entry and exit-IP addresses is the safest one.
